To provide an exceptional patient experience by managing the reception area and coordinating treatment plans. This dual role ensures smooth administrative operations, effective communication with patients, and support for clinical and managerial functions.
Responsibilities
- Manage the reception area during surgery opening hours, ensuring a professional and welcoming environment.
- Answer telephone calls promptly and courteously, book appointments accurately using the SFD system, and confirm appointments with patients.
- Greet patients, assist with forms (medical history, consent), and maintain accurate patient records.
- Process payments (cash, card, finance options) and issue receipts; reconcile daily reports.
- Handle administrative tasks such as typing, photocopying, scanning, and updating practice guidelines.
- Order stationery and medical supplies, monitor stock levels for antibiotics, whitening products, and sundry items.
- Maintain a tidy and safe waiting area, ensuring leaflets and posters are appropriate and well-stocked.
- Liaise with laboratories for dental work, manage deliveries and returns.
- Assist with patient transport arrangements when required.
- Ensure compliance with data protection and confidentiality standards.
Treatment Coordination Duties
- Meet new patients in a non-clinical setting to discuss treatment options before and after dentist consultations.
- Explain treatment plans, consent forms, and finance options clearly and professionally.
- Maintain accurate records of all patient discussions and treatment agreements.
- Arrange future appointments and follow-up calls to ensure continuity of care.
- Monitor and manage treatment conversions, recalls, and outstanding treatments.
- Take before-and-after photographs, collect testimonials, and conduct patient interviews for marketing purposes.
- Support marketing initiatives: social media posts, open evenings, and local advertising campaigns.
- Handle patient complaints professionally, liaising with the Clinic Manager for resolution.
- Ensure patient accounts are settled according to practice procedures.
Additional Responsibilities
- Assist the Clinic Manager with staff monitoring, compliance checks, and stock control.
- Cover reception or nursing duties when required (if GDC registered).
- Participate in weekly and monthly meetings, contributing to practice development.
- Uphold internal marketing standards and monitor patient feedback.
